As a small aside Mark Knoppfler is from Newcastle, one of the northernmost English cities. For such a small country, England exhibits an extraordinary diversity of regional dialects; "Geordie" (as the Newcastle version is known) is one of the most distinctive, retaining many Old English and Viking phrases as part of the local slang lexicon.
